三叉神经中脑核内假单极神经元的电生理和形态特性  

ELECTROPHYSIOLOGICAL AND MORPHOLOGICAL PROPERTIES OF THE PSEUDOUNIPOLAR NEURONS IN MESENCEPHALIC TRIGEMINAL NUCLEUS

摘  要:为了探讨三叉神经中脑核(Vme)神经元的电生理和形态学特征,本研究应用红外可视脑片膜片钳技术、biocytin细胞内标记技术以及免疫组织化学染色方法观察大鼠Vme内假单极神经元的电生理和形态学特征。结果显示:(1)长时程去极化方波刺激能够引起Vme神经元重复放电,且根据放电模式的不同,可将其分为快适应型神经元和慢适应型神经元两种类型,其中快适应型神经元占绝大多数;(2)经biocytin细胞内标记并染色后,光学显微镜下观察两种类型的Vme神经元在形态上均为假单极神经元,无显著差别。以上结果提示:形态学类型相同的Vme神经元的电生理学特点具有多样性,这可能与Vme神经元担负复杂的口面部本体觉信息的传递功能有关。To explore the electrophysiological and morphological properties of the neurons in the mesencephalic trigeminal nucleus (Vme), infrared visualized brain slice patch clamp combined with intracellular biocytin labeling and immunohistochemistry was employed to observe the electrophysiological properties and morphological characteristics of the pseudounipolar neurons of rat Vme. The present results showed that: ( 1 ) Repetitive neuronal discharges of Vme could be evoked by long term square wave depolarizing stimulus. The neurons could be divided into two types, rapid-adapting neurons and slow-adapting neurons, according to their different discharge patterns, and the majority of which was the rapid-adapting type; (2) There was no morphologically significant difference between such two types of Vme neurons which were labeled by the biocytin iontophoresed into Vme neuronal cell bodies and stained immunohistochamically. The present results suggest that morphologically identical Vme neurons may show diversified electrophysiological properties and may be involved into sophisticated functional transmission of oral-facial proprioceptive sensation.
